I have a Tohatsu M60B that has developed a strange squeal. It sounds similar to a loose fan belt on a car. It only develops after the engine has had time to warm up and does it sporadically throughout the RPM range. It sounds like it is coming from the engine block and not from the foot, but I have not been able to pinpoint the location. Any idea what this might be? Could the fly wheel be loose?

Squeals on an engine without a belt are usually associated with metal on metal binding. That's always a BAD THING. The flywheel key could have sheared, but unless you hit something in the water it's pretty rare. Sometimes the trigger plate under the flywheel can come loose so you might want to check that.

Since this engine does not have a camshaft that's the one thing you do not have to lose sleep over. It might be crankshaft related, but you will have to tear the engine apart to find out.

I once saw a bad mag side crank seal on a motorcycle cause a bad squeal/screech. Took forever and a factory service school instructor to figure it out.

on a mercury there are little hoses that feed lubricant to the crank bearings. i dont know if the tohatsu has them but if the lines get plugged they will make a squealing noise.
